Transaction d2560d46649ce2931ac0f160d565420132426ecdaeaa53f84cb23f3f8f3f733e
1 Input
1 Output
-
d2560d46649ce2931ac0f160d565420132426ecdaeaa53f84cb23f3f8f3f733e:0
- value
- 1659000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 25c5d7e67d4429aadcbe4c5566d9401150e27cc6 OP_EQUAL
- address
- 358jw3E2xuyVYBPBLoKEiRrwiKVsK3GYHG